Reporting to the Head of UX, the UX Designer will play a key role in crafting seamless and engaging user and customer experiences. You will work collaboratively across teams to understand user needs, map customer journeys, and design intuitive solutions that deliver value and drive satisfaction. This is a unique opportunity to shape the future of retirement experiences for a new audience. Role Accountabilities

Conduct user testing (e.g., interviews, usability testing, surveys) to gather insights into the needs, behaviours, and pain points of Gen X users. Translate user insights into personas, journey maps, and other design artifacts. Design wireframes, prototypes, and high-fidelity user interfaces that align with business goals and user needs. Work closely in cross-functional teams, including Product, Engineering, Marketing, and Content, to ensure designs align with strategic objectives. Partner with the Head of UX to implement design strategies and processes. Participate in design critiques, offering and receiving constructive feedback. Ensure designs are inclusive and accessible, meeting relevant standards (e.g., WCAG). Consider the diverse financial literacy and digital proficiency levels of target users in design solutions. Contribute to the maintenance and evolution of the design system, ensuring consistency across digital products. Leverage data to prioritise design decisions and measure the success of design updates. Skills and Knowledge

Strong portfolio showcasing user-centered design work, including wireframes, prototypes, and customer journey maps. Proficiency in design tools such as Figma, Sketch, or Adobe Creative Suite. A customer-focused self-starter. Understanding of UX testing methodologies and data-driven design principles. Strong communication and relationship building skills. Flexibility to adjust to multiple demands, shifting priorities, ambiguity and rapid change. Experience

2-5 years of experience in UX design or related roles. Experience of working in a fast-paced environment. Company Benefits
